Schema design best practice #1: Do not choose a column whose value monotonically increases or decreases as the first key part for a high write rate table. A table column should be a quality common to all members of an object class and should have a name that corresponds to the way that plain language refers to the property such as First_Name, Amount, Measure, Number, Quantity or Text. Never apply the collective name to the property, such as having an Employee_name property in an Employee table.
